We are looking for a 3D artist to join Jam City’s narrative game team and contribute to a new title currently in development. In this role, you will create high‑quality 3D visuals by modeling and texturing props, environments, and characters, and then implementing these assets in the game engine.

A link to an online portfolio, website, or PDF with recent work samples is required for the application.

Responsibilities
• Produce top‑quality 3D models and textures.
• Build high‑quality, optimized 3D environments, props, and characters.
• Work with the Art Lead and Art Director to define and maintain the project’s visual style.
• Identify and resolve visual issues related to in‑game assets and how characters interact with their surroundings.
• Pinpoint and improve pipeline efficiencies for more effective asset production.
• Communicate with the Lead Artist, Art Director, producers, and other project stakeholders about tasks and deadlines.
• Solve artistic and technical challenges during development.
• Occasionally support the tech art team with basic rigging and skinning tasks.

Requirements
• At least 3 years of experience in 3D game development.
• Experience contributing to at least one fully released 3D game project.
• Strong skills in Maya and the Adobe Creative Suite.
• Understanding of rendering and real‑time shader development.
• Experience with Substance Painter and PBR materials.
• Ability to work across different themes and artistic styles.
• Solid understanding of environment and character art workflows.
• Good knowledge of human and animal anatomy.
• Excellent grasp of composition, color, value, and form in both traditional art and game graphics.
• Deep understanding of the 3D game development pipeline and experience collaborating with engineering and design teams.
• Strong problem‑solving abilities.
• Art degree or equivalent professional experience.
• Experience with Unity.
• Very strong spoken and written English skills.

Bonus
• Strong abilities in 2D concept art and illustration.
• Rigging experience in Maya.
• Maya scripting skills (MEL or Python).
• Experience creating shaders using shader‑graph tools.
• Knowledge of Substance Designer.
• Experience with ZBrush.
